Immunovia AB (publ)
IMMVF · OTC
12/31/2024 | 12/31/2023 | 12/31/2022 | 12/31/2021 | |
|---|---|---|---|---|
| Market Cap | $67 | $67 | $799 | $1,631 |
| - Cash | $25 | $77 | $106 | $287 |
| + Debt | $1 | $4 | $38 | $33 |
| Enterprise Value | $43 | -$6 | $731 | $1,377 |
| Revenue | $1 | $2 | $1 | $1 |
| % Growth | -40.9% | 37.6% | 35.7% | – |
| Gross Profit | $1 | -$5 | -$3 | $16 |
| % Margin | 100% | -324.3% | -267.8% | 1,873.6% |
| EBITDA | -$61 | -$148 | -$142 | -$135 |
| % Margin | -6,580.6% | -9,426.2% | -12,365% | -16,051.1% |
| Net Income | -$77 | -$309 | -$168 | -$156 |
| % Margin | -8,221.4% | -19,646.9% | -14,680.5% | -18,479.4% |
| EPS Diluted | -0.93 | -7.95 | -6.89 | -6.4 |
| % Growth | 88.3% | -15.4% | -7.7% | – |
| Operating Cash Flow | -$97 | -$147 | -$176 | -$153 |
| Capital Expenditures | $0 | -$1 | -$2 | -$24 |
| Free Cash Flow | -$97 | -$148 | -$177 | -$177 |